Babergh - Street Trading Control Resolution
What is happening?
PUBLIC NOTICE OF PASSED STREET TRADING RESOLUTION
Local Government (Miscellaneous Provisions) Act 1982 – Schedule 4
Notice is hereby given that Babergh District Council passed a resolution under Para 2 of Schedule 4 of the Local Government (Miscellaneous Provisions) Act 1982 to designate streets within its area for the purposes of street trading control.
The passed resolution will prohibit the A12 and A14 and designate all other streets within the Babergh District Council area as “Consent Streets”, which means that street trading will only be permitted with the consent of the Council.
The Council resolved to:
1. Designate all streets, including laybys, within the Babergh District Council area as Consent Streets under Para 2(1)(c) of Schedule 4 of the Act.
2. Designate the A12 and A14 within the Babergh District Council area as prohibited streets under Para 2(1)(a) of Schedule 4 of the Act.
The decision to pass the resolution was made by Babergh District Council on 23 June 2026.
The resolution will come into effect on the 1 August 2026.
Dated: 7 July 2026
Babergh District Council
